I hope this message finds you well. I am writing to bring to your attention an issue I have been experiencing while using ChatGPT. Frequently, I encounter the error message "internal sever error" during my sessions, particularly when I am engaged in a conversation with an extensive history.
To troubleshoot the issue, I have tried changing my network environment and even used a VPN to ensure the stability of my connection. However, the problem persists. I have noticed that this error tends to occur mainly in sessions where there is a long history of communication.
I would like to know if there are any limits to the length or number of questions in a single session. If such limits exist, it would be helpful to have this information upfront. I am aware that longer session histories might lead to increased processing times, and I am willing to wait for a response. However, it is frustrating to wait only to receive an error message. Based on the information provided in the knowledge sources, there doesn't seem to be any explicit limit on the length or number of questions in a single session for ChatGPT Enterprise, as it has no usage caps source (https://help.openai.com/en/articles/8266413-what-are-chatgpt-enterprise-s-max-message-limits). However, it's important to note that this doesn't necessarily mean there are no technical limitations that could potentially cause issues during extensive sessions.

While it's not directly mentioned in the sources, it's possible that very long conversation histories could potentially lead to increased processing times or other technical issues. If you're experiencing persistent issues, it might be worth trying to limit the length of your sessions to see if this helps.

If you've already tried changing your network environment and the issue persists, it might not be a network issue. However, it's worth noting that company network or VPN policies can sometimes make it difficult to access ChatGPT source (https://help.openai.com/en/articles/9047779-why-is-my-chatgpt-taking-so-long-to-respond).
